* Bishop Austrans is a kind of hybrid rail system that can be flexibly
deployed in an urban setting. It is claimed it can actually run a
profitable public transport system without subsidies.

 "Its greatest strengths are the vehicle frequency (initially up to one
 every 15 seconds), the low cost of construction and operation and very
 low environmental impacts."

* The Solar Tower, to be built by EnviroMission is huge upside-down
funnel, 1km high, with massive power generation capacity.

 "EnviroMission owns the exclusive license to German designed Solar Tower
 technology in Australia. Our first project will focus on developing this
 revolutionary technology into the world's first large-scale solar thermal
 power station capable of generating enough electricity to supply 200,000
 typical Australian homes."
